Robbie A. Magnotta, 43, died suddenly Friday, December 16, 2011 at his home at the Zorn Road Residence. Born in Troy on June 21, 1968, Robbie attended school at St. Anthony's in Troy, Bell Top School in East Greenbush and Doyle Middle School in Troy. He was a graduate of the Wildwood Program...
